Default safe area?

Hi everyone...
Looking at sharing a house at 215/Rainbow Rd...
a) is this a good/safe area? is there anything to be worried about aside from regular city precautions.....have enough to worry about, dont want to worry about getting robbed, constant noise, or drug issues...Thanks in advance!

Not sure what your priorites might be. How well do you know your potential roommie? If you're not sure you can trust their opinion, probably not a good idea regardless of location.

Of the items you mentiond, noise may be the biggest problem. But, even then, you would be best served by parking in the neighborhood at various times of the day or night to check out the noise. Its not a bad area, but that kind of commitment deserves some personal research.

I would point out that there are two 215 and Rainbows...I presume he means the southern one.

I would think that reasonble suburban area if not too close to the freeway.

89118 gets a little tough but only over toward 15 and the strip.

I used to work over by 215/Rainbow for a period of over 6 months...There's lots of traffic, but other than that, it is very quiet in and around the neighborhoods...There's a police substation at Rainbow/Windmill so there may be noise from that, but it can also be a pro...
